The Basics of Runway Designations

First, let’s peel back the layers on how runways are numbered. You might wonder, why 31? It’s not just a random choice. Runway numbers are derived from their magnetic heading, which is the direction the runway points. It’s rounded to the nearest 10 degrees. Why Magnetic Over True Heading?

Let's get a bit geeky for a moment (because why not?). You may hear terms like "true heading" vs. "magnetic heading." What's the deal? The Earth’s magnetic field is not uniform and can vary depending on where you are. So, while the true north is static, magnetic north can play a bit of hide-and-seek due to shifts in the Earth’s magnetosphere. For aviators, it’s essential to use magnetic headings for precision, especially in takeoff and landing scenarios.
